We are in the youth month,16 June 1976 was when the youth of South Africa picketed in a stance to fight against the rampant racism and the quality of education of that epoch.The well known cliché and epithet that is used to describe that incident of 16 June 1976 is“The Soweto Uprisings”; the youth of 1976 confronted the mightiest apartheid military regime in Africa.

A plethora of Soweto students perished in 1976.Those are the heroes to be honored with dignity. From that day socio-political landscape in South Africa was changed tremendously. Today’s youth must take a leaf from the youth of 1976.

Alot of blood was shed during that era including our heroes Hector Pieterson, Hastings Ndlovu and a gallant political activist Tsietsi Mashinini to mention a few. Hector was shot and killed by the brutality of that apartheid regime.This must struck a chord in all the youth of South Africa.
